免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

如何七天开发一套app

开发一套app并不是一件轻松简单的事情,需要有一定的技术基础和开发经验。但是,如果你已经有了一些基础,那么七天时间开发一套app也是可以做到的。下面,我将详细介绍如何在七天时间内开发一套app。

第一天:需求分析和UI设计

在第一天,你需要先了解你要开发的app的功能和需求,这是开发app的第一步。可以和你的团队或者客户进行沟通,了解客户的需求和目标用户的喜好。然后,你需要根据需求设计出app的UI,包括颜色、字体、按钮等等。你可以使用一些设计工具,比如Sketch、Photoshop等等,来进行UI设计。

第二天:原型设计和功能规划

在第二天,你需要将UI设计转化为原型设计。原型设计是app开发的关键步骤之一,它能够帮助你更好地理解app的功能和流程。你可以使用一些原型设计工具,比如Axure、Sketch等等,来进行原型设计。同时,你需要对app的功能进行规划,包括哪些功能是必须的,哪些是可选的,这些功能之间的关系等等。

第三天:数据库设计和API开发

在第三天,你需要进行数据库设计和API开发。你需要了解app需要存储哪些数据,以及这些数据之间的关系。然后,你需要设计数据库结构,并进行数据库的创建和连接。接着,你需要开发API,用于实现与数据库的交互,包括数据的读取、写入、更新和删除等操作。

第四天:前端开发

在第四天,你需要进行前端开发。你需要使用一些前端框架和技术,比如React、Angular、Vue等等,来实现app的前端功能。前端开发包括页面的开发、交互的实现、数据的展示等等。在开发过程中,你需要进行测试和调试,确保app的功能和流程正常。

第五天:后端开发

在第五天,你需要进行后端开发。你需要使用一些后端框架和技术,比如Node.js、Python、Ruby等等,来实现app的后端功能。后端开发包括API的实现、数据的处理、安全性的保障等等。在开发过程中,你需要进行测试和调试,确保app的后端功能正常。

第六天:集成和测试

在第六天,你需要进行集成和测试。你需要将前端和后端集成起来,并进行测试和调试。在测试过程中,你需要测试app的各个功能和流程,包括数据的读取、写入、更新和删除等操作,以及安全性和性能等方面。

第七天:上线和发布

在第七天,你需要将app上线和发布。你需要将app部署到服务器上,并进行一些必要的配置和优化。然后,你需要将app发布到各个应用商店和平台上,比如App Store、Google Play等等。在发布过程中,你需要遵守相应的规定和要求,以确保app的合法性和质量。

总结

七天开发一套app需要有一定的技术基础和开发经验,但是只要你有充足的时间和精力,这是完全可以做到的。在开发过程中,你需要进行需求分析和UI设计、原型设计和功能规划、数据库设计和API开发、前端开发、后端开发、集成和测试、上线和发布等一系列步骤。通过这些步骤的完整实施,你能够成功地开发出一套高质量的app,并为用户带来良好的使用体验。


相关知识:
睿科创新app定制开发
睿科创新app是一款基于人工智能技术的智能客服应用程序,能够实现自动回答用户的问题、提供客户服务、进行智能分析和推荐等功能。它可以帮助企业提高客户满意度,降低客户服务成本,提高运营效率,增强品牌形象。在这篇文章中,我们将详细介绍睿科创新app的定制开发原理
2024-01-10
dart开发app实战
Dart是一种面向对象的编程语言,由Google开发,并被用作编写包括移动应用、Web应用、桌面应用和服务器端应用在内的多种类型的应用程序。在本文中,我们将详细讨论Dart开发移动应用的实战技巧。首先,我们需要准备好Dart的开发环境。在开始之前,确保已经
2023-07-14
app是怎么开发
App开发是指通过编程语言和开发工具将一个应用程序制作成可在移动设备上运行的软件。本文将从需求分析、设计、开发和发布等几个方面对App开发进行详细介绍。一、需求分析:在开始开发一个App之前,首先需要进行需求分析,明确开发的目标和功能。开发者需要与客户或使
2023-07-14
app开发企业应该具备哪些思维
作为一个专注于互联网领域的网站博主,我很荣幸能够为您介绍一下app开发企业应该具备的思维。在如今移动互联网的时代,app开发已经成为了许多企业的重要业务之一。一个成功的app开发企业需要具备以下几个关键思维:1. 用户思维:一个成功的app开发企业应该始终
2023-06-29
app后端开发包括什么
App 后端开发是指为移动应用开发提供后台支撑的技术过程。它包括了开发必要的服务器端的软件,创建必要的数据存储和处理机制等等,用于提供支撑移动应用相关业务的基础设施和数据。App 后端开发与传统的 Web 后端开发的区别在于,移动应用的交互方式和数据传输方
2023-05-06
apple tv开发
Apple TV 是一种基于 iOS 操作系统的网络媒体播放器。它能够将在 Apple 设备上下载的视频、音频、图片和应用程序等内容通过 Wi-Fi 网络连接播放到电视机上,为用户提供更加丰富的娱乐和学习体验。本文将介绍 Apple TV 开发的原理和详细
2023-05-06